A principal was spending 3 hours a week on social media. We didn’t give her AI tools. We built her an AI team member trained on her school, voice, and goals. Now she spends 15 minutes approving posts. AI isn’t a tool. It’s a teammate you train.

Every teacher asks: “How do I know if this is AI?” Stop detecting. Start making thinking visible. When students show how they arrived at an answer—not just what it is—AI stops being a shortcut. Design for process, not product.

You weren’t hired to be plagiarism patrol—you’re an educator. If AI can finish an assignment in 30 seconds, the problem isn’t the tool. It’s the task. Design work that invites thinking, reflection, and creation—and cheating loses its appeal.
